Excellent. This is the same recipe that my Granny has been making for about 15 years now. The biggest thing to note is that IF you are using pineapples in heavy syrup then of course you don't need extra sugar (as some reviews has said, because heavy syrup is sugar). If you use pineapples in their own juice with no added sugar then you can safely add the sugar. Also I made this recipe gluten free by changing some of the ingredients to gluten free ingredients and it came out just great. You can buy gluten free crackers and use gluten free flour in place of the gluten filled ingredients

This was a really tasty side dish. I only used 1/2 cup of sugar and that was plenty. Also I like to use pineapple tidbits better than chunks since they are smaller and make the flavors and textures mesh better. I drained my pineapple out of the can and reserved the juice for later uses, also I did not add the 8 tablespoons of juice since the pineapple were still very juicey. I think the extra 8 tablespoons would have made this casserole too mushy for many tastebuds (including mine.) Thanks for this recipe, it's a keeper.
